6.Sh NAME
7.Nm accton
8.Nd enable/disable system accounting
9.Sh SYNOPSIS
10.Nm accton
11.Op Ar acctfile
12.Sh DESCRIPTION
13The
14.Nm
15command is used
16for switching system accounting on or off.
17If called with the argument
18.Ar acctfile ,
19system accounting is enabled and a record of
20every process that is started by the
21.Xr execve 2
22system call and then later exits the system is stored in
23.Ar acctfile .
24The
25.Xr sa 8
26command may be used to examining the accounting records.
27If no arguments are given, system account is disabled.
28.Sh FILES
29.Bl -tag -width /var/account/acct
30.It Pa /var/account/acct
31Default accounting file.
